On Monday 24 April 2006 14:21, Matthias Andree wrote: > > I have the following line in my /etc/leafnode/config: > > > > server = news.spamcop.net > > > > However, leafnode doesn't see the spamcop newsgroup. It's not in > > the /var/spool/news/leaf.node/groupinfo file > > I just tried with 1.11.5, it lists the newsgroup when asked for the > group list (LIST or LIST ACTIVE spam*), I can enter it (GROUP spamcop), > so we'll probably need more detail to figure what's going on with your > version. As a first step, try running "fetchnews -f" to see if > re-retrieving the group list fixes the issue. Yes, that fixed it. I think the problem was that I had previously had the following line for the spamcop server in my config file: only_groups_pcre = spamcop\. I removed this line after I noticed that the spamcop newsgroup was missing. (I should have omitted the "\." when I added that line in the first place.) I had assumed that Leafnode would detect that the config file had changed and update its group list. My assumption turned out to be incorrect. Perhaps there is a good reason for this behaviour, but if not I suggest that it be changed.
